We are a private practice in the Longhurst Health complex, comprising of qualified, understanding and passionate therapists. The following services are available for both adults and children:
· Assessment and treatment of a wide range of communication disorders including speech sound delays and disorders, language delays and disorders, phonological awareness, fluency/stuttering, motor speech disorders, accent reduction, and general communication skills
· Group seminars, information sessions, and workshops for parents, whanau, educators and other professionals

We are based at the Longhurst Health complex in Halswell, Christchurch and are able to open late nights or Saturdays by appointment. We also offer our services in your home or school in Christchurch if necessary for your needs, and work one day a week in Ashburton.

A simple song can help soothe and regulate kids’ emotions. Singing and rocking helps the lower brain and sensory system provide self-regulation. Nursery rhymes contain all the rhythmic patterns of early childhood: walking, running, skipping and galloping.

Struggling to find a speech-language therapist (SLT)? You’re not alone.

Aotearoa has only around 22 SLTs per 100,000 people – among the lowest rates in the OECD. That means long waitlists and people missing out on help to communicate and swallow safely.

NZSTA is calling for targeted investment in three high-need areas:
🔹 Assistive Technology & AAC – so people who rely on devices are not waiting years to have a voice
🔹 Dementia – keeping people connected, independent and safe for longer
🔹 Residential disability services – making sure it is safe to eat and free to communicate in every home

It can be hard to know when to seek help with your child’s eating, especially when so many people say, “They’ll grow out of it.”. But it may be more than just “picky eating.”

Feeding therapy helps you understand what’s behind your child’s eating patterns and gives you practical tools to make mealtimes feel less overwhelming and more successful.
